Responsibilities

Conducts analysis and investigations of consumer and customer complaints and quality related losses, develops corrective actions and monitors effectiveness.

Ensures an active internal quality audit program in compliance with BRC, AIB, and KEFSQ.

Ensures update of HAACP and SOPs as needed, makes sure associates of all levels are trained on quality programs.

Manages relationships with internal and external customers, suppliers, colleagues, and support services to ensure achievement of targets.

Drive continuous improvement for quality related metrics and KPIs both at the local and regional levels.

Attend MDI DDS to inform and coach high level performance of key KPIs.

Oversee FM investigations to ensure root cause is determined and a cross functional approach.

Oversee on time positive release of finished goods to include the oversight of rework, dilution, downgrades, and donations.

Retain finished goods samples and set up sensory panel daily.

What you’ll need to be successful

Bachelor’s degree in Microbiology, Chemistry, Food Science, or another related field is required

HAACP, PCQI certifications preferred, BRC audit training preferred

4+ years of experience in manufacturing required, food manufacturing strongly preferred

2+ years of leadership experience required

Experience with SAP is preferred

Strong technical skills in area of focus (microbiology and/or chemistry) with ability to interpret general technical and scientific results and perform analytical tests

Sound mathematical and basic food science understanding

Good knowledge of statistics and interpretation of experimental data

Basic understanding of the manufacturing environment and production operations

Experience working with customers/vendors, continuous improvement projects

Strong understanding of food safety and basic food regulatory requirements

Ability to independently read, comprehend, and communicate in basic English and interact with all levels of the organization

Ability to independently carry out instructions furnished in written, oral, or diagram form

About the team The FSQ Supervisor will have 10 direct reports total from two crews of the food safety and quality department — leadership responsibilities will include scheduling and assigning work, providing training, ensuring tasks are completed, and promoting continuous improvement and learning for team members.
